HVAC repair costs change based on a few key factors. The specific mechanical issue, the accessibility of the unit, and the age or model of your system all play a role. If a technician needs to source rare or hard-to-find parts, that can shift the total. Additionally, the labor hours required to troubleshoot complex electrical or refrigerant leaks will impact the final bill. RV AC repair services involve diagnosing and fixing the air conditioning unit specifically designed for recreational vehicles. These units often differ from standard home ACs in size, power requirements, and installation. Technicians will inspect components like the compressor, fan, and thermostat. Repairs might include refrigerant recharging, leak detection, or part replacement. Ensuring your RV stays cool is key for enjoyable trips. Seek experienced RV AC technicians.

Heat pump rep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ues with systems that provide both heating and cooling. Technicians will check components like the reversing valve, refrigerant levels, and electrical controls. Common problems include reduced efficiency, strange noises, or the unit not heating or cooling effectively. Proper repair ensures consistent comfort and energy efficiency. Signs your AC needs service and repair near you in Kenosha include reduced cooling, unusual noises, or strange odors. If your unit is constantly running without cooling, or if you notice a significant increase in your energy bill, it's time for an inspection. Water leaks around the indoor unit can also indicate a problem. Prompt service prevents minor issues from becoming major repairs. Call us for an assessment.
